How to obtain the Florida Supreme Court Approved Family Law Form 12 981a
Individuals can obtain the Florida Supreme Court Approved Family Law Form 12 981a through various means. The form is available on the official Florida state court website, where users can download and print it for their use. Additionally, local courthouse clerks may provide physical copies of the form upon request. It is important to ensure that the most current version of the form is being used to avoid any issues during the filing process.
